Hallo,
ich mache gerade erste Versuche, ein XML-Dokument, das über XInclude ein
weiteres XML-Dokument einbindet, mit Java 5.0 zu parsen. Leider funktioniert
das nicht so, wie ich denke, dass es funktionieren sollte.
Meine XML-Datei sieht so aus:
<?xml version="1.0" encoding="ISO-8859-1"?>
<data xmlns:xi="http://www.w3.org/2001/XInclude">
Am Samstag, 9. Juli 2005 12:54 schrieb Ralf Schneider:
Geparst wird die Datei mit folgendem Code:
DocumentBuilderFactory dbf = DocumentBuilderFactory.newInstance(); dbf.setXIncludeAware(true); DocumentBuilder dom = dbf.newDocumentBuilder(); document = dom.parse (file);
Ich habs mittlerweile selbst rausgefunden. Es fehlt noch ein dbf.setNamespaceAware (true); Dann funktioniert's prima. Viele Grüße, Ralf.
participants (1)
-
Ralf Schneider